20 Sep, Tue 10:00AM Mt Banks one trail loop
Grade:3/6 Length 12km  400m Sydney Branch
(SWAG) Ewan C.
Walk | A bushwalk of any kind short or longBooking opens 2 weeks prior to event.  The track leads off to the south from the Bell's Line of Road between Mount Tomah and the Mount Wilson turn-off, and there is a sign indicating Mount Banks. You can park at the end of the road. Walk out to the lookout and return over the top. This is a lovely walk and not too difficult. There are superb views of the Grose Valley at the lookout and wonderful northern views as you come down off Mount Banks. There are many wildflowers at this time of the year. We'll visit Mount Tomah to see the beautiful waratahs and proteas on the way home. View

21 Sep, Wed 8:41AM Heathcote to Uloola Falls via Karloo Pool
Grade:3/6 Length 11km  350m Southern Sydney Branch
Paul L.
Walk | A bushwalk of any kind short or longFully Vaccinated | All participants must be able to show proof they are fully vaccinated against COVID-19 to particpate.Public Transport | There are public transport options to and from this activity.Walk starting and ending at Heathcote Station, going via Karloo Pool to Uloola Falls. Returning to Karloo Pool and down Kangaroo Creek toward Olympic Pool. Walk is on tracks, but sections are eroded and in need of repair, muddy if rain has occurred. Hazards include creek crossings and exposed sections of track over rock.
Location: Royal National Park
Map: Royal NP Limit: 15. View

26 Sep, Mon 9:25AM Darri Track
Grade:3/6 Length 9km  240m Sydney Branch
Renate W.
Walk | A bushwalk of any kind short or longFully Vaccinated | All participants must be able to show proof they are fully vaccinated against COVID-19 to particpate.Public Transport | There are public transport options to and from this activity.This walk takes the Darri Track along the headwaters of Cowan Creek to the junction with the Warrimoo Track. After skirting behind some houses it joins the fire trail which heads steeply down to Ku-Ring-Gai Creek, then climbs up on bush tracks to the Ku-ring-gai Wildflower Garden. Hazards: Creek crossings, slippery when wet, steep bush tracks.
Location: St Ives Chase
Map: Ku-ring-gai Chase Limit: 14. View

26 Sep, Mon 8:55AM Pindar Cave
Grade:4/6 Length 13km  490m Sydney Branch
Renate W.
Walk | A bushwalk of any kind short or longFully Vaccinated | All participants must be able to show proof they are fully vaccinated against COVID-19 to particpate.Public Transport | There are public transport options to and from this activity.(Cancelled) The walk will be led by Mike Pickles. This walk takes you to a less visited part of Brisbane Waters National Park to the spectacular Pindar Cave, with an option to continue to a waterfall, before returning the same way. It starts with a steep climb from Wondabyne station, then follows tracks which are eroded in places, muddy and slippery, with short rock scrambles. Wildflowers should be abundant; hopefully the orchids will still be in flower. Hazards: eroded track, muddy and slippery sections, short rock scrambles.
Location: Brisbane Water NP
Map: Brisbane Water NP Limit: 14. View

28 Sep, Wed 8:24AM Panola Cave
Grade:4/6 Length 18km  530m Southern Sydney Branch
Loan
Walk | A bushwalk of any kind short or longFrom Waterfall Station following Couranga Track then crossing Hacking River. Walking to Southern part of the shady Forest Path Circuit. Then short walk along Lady Carrington Drive and on to Palona Cave. Unusual limestone overhangs with some stalagmites and stalactites and waterfall near the cave. Return via the Northern section of the Forest Path Circuit and uphill return on Couranga Track to Waterfall Station. Please provide mobile no, NPA no and emergency contact no. Steep rocky path in places, slippery when wet and overgrown bush. Limit: 15. View

1 Oct, Sat 8:30AM Circuit from Bells Line Of Road via Jinki and Kamarah Ridges
Grade:4/6 Length 11km  360m Sydney Branch
8612
Walk | A bushwalk of any kind short or longFrom Bells Line Of Road we follow Jinki Ridge before descending to Jungaburra Brook which is crossed a few times before ascending to Jungaburra Ridge followed by Kamarah Ridge and then returning to Bells Line Of Road. This is a spectacular area containing pagodas, gullies, cliffs and fabulous views of the Grose Gorge. Tracks, off-track, ascent of a 5m rockface using climbers fixed steel rungs and fixed rope, scrambling and creek crossings. Off-track slip and trip hazards, slight chance of wet feet on creek crossings. Must be agile enough to climb the fixed steel rungs on a rockface. Snakes will be out and about.
Location: Blue Mountains NP
Map: Mount Wilson 89301N Limit: 12. View
